What Is the Drawing Base and Why Does It Matter?
The drawing base is the initial layer beneath your final artwork—a transparent or semi-transparent surface intended to support shading, build value, or establish depth before colors and details are added. Think of it as your artwork’s “canvas foundation,” designed to enhance not obscure your vision.
Most artists either use plain white paper, leave the screen blank, or rely on heavy-textured paper without prepping it properly—all of which limit tonal control and clarity.

The Overlooked Secret: A Light-Washed Foundation Layer
The most overlooked drawing base isn’t just paper or a neutral surface—it’s a light-washed underpainting layer. This thin, opaque but translucent layer sets the tone for your entire composition, making shading smoother and colors more vibrant.
Why This Layer is a Game-Changer:
- Enhances Value Contrast: Lightgespreädt tones guide your lighting and shadow with precision.
- Improves Paper or Screen Dynamics: Prevents glare and reduces surface grit, especially on digital tablets or textured paper.
- Boosts Color Saturation: A neutral base reflects light evenly, allowing pigment to appear richer and deeper.
- Streamlines Review: Easier to adjust tones without disturbing underlying values.

How to Create Your Ultimate Drawing Base
On Paper:
- Choose Smooth, Heavy-Weight Paper (160–300 gsm).
- Light Wash with Neutral Tones: Use water—or digital soft brushes in digital—applying a full-coverage but transparent layer in grays, soft blues, or warm grays.
- Let It Dry Completely before drawing to avoid smudging.
Digitally (Photoshop, Procreate, Clip Studio Paint):
- Add a New Layer and use low-opacity, soft-edged brushes.
- Select Neutral Tones: Try #D3D6E7 (pale gray), #F5F0E6 (light beige), or #A9A3B6 (cool greys).
- Set Blending Mode to Soft Light or Overlay for subtle tonal enhancement without losing detail.
Pro Tips to Use Your Drawing Base Effectively
- Vary Tonal Density: Adjust the base’s intensity to match your lighting scheme—darker bases for high-key scenes, lighter for low-key.
- Use It as a Reference Guide: Lightly sketch key values directly on the base for consistency.
- Keep It Unobtrusive: A clean, subtly toned base supports your art, doesn’t dominate it.
